I purchased this brand not really knowing what it was going to be like. I usually purchase the well-known brand of Castile Soap, but found this one to be a bit more reasonably priced. I took a leap of faith and I am happy I did.First, I make my own handwashing soap using my top-quality essential oils. For an 8 oz bottle, I used about 3.5 oz of castile soap, 1 oz of vegetable glycerin, 40 drops of my oils, and then topped it off with filtered water. I shook it up well and this brand of Castile soap worked just as good if not better than the well-known brand.The foam consistency was great and creamy without leaving a soapy residue or drying out my skin (the vegetable glycerin helps with this as well). It did not clog up my dispenser, which I am extremely pleased about. There is NO unpleasant smell or odor with this brand.
